Describe the combustible: it requires to understand the kind of > fire that is suitable for an extinguisher : It can be subjective as the > brakets denote in the table here > https://en.wikipedia.org/wiki/Fire_extinguisher#United_Kingdom > Also we would potentially have multiple keys e.g. > fire_extinguisher_class=ordinary_combustibles;flammable > liquid;electricity > > we could have a table in the wiki that defines human readable values for the classes that you can see on the extinguisher, e.g. Comparison of fire classes American European UK Australian/Asian Fuel/heat source Class A Class A Class A Class A Ordinary combustibles Class B Class B Class B Class B Flammable liquids Class C Class C Class C Flammable gases Class C UNCLASSIFIED UNCLASSIFIED Class E Electrical equipment Class D Class D Class D Class D Combustible metals Class K Class F Class F Class F Cooking oil or fat The tag name could also be more explicit, e.g. fire_extinguisher_for_fire_type or for_fire_type the values could be ordinary_combustibles (or maybe "generic", "normal", "ordinary"?), liquids, gases, electrical, metals, fat > > 1. Describe the kind of combustible: again it requires to understand > the kind of fire that is suitable for an extinguisher > > again, could be a translation table in the wiki to normalize local standard to normalized human readable value > > 1. > 2. Describe the type of powder: could be a good solution but the bad > think is that we would potentially have multiple keys e.g. > fire_extinguisher_class=water;foam;dry_powder > > the usual solution for avoiding multiple values is putting them in the key, e.g. fire_extinguisher_agent:water=yes or more linguistically correct extinguishing_agent:water=yes My choice would be "5. Describe the type of powder" with the following keys: > > - water > - foam > - dry_powder > - co2 > - wet_chemical > - class_D > - halon > > These seem to be different types of descriptions, water, co2 and halon are describing the chemical material or group of materials foam, dry_powder, wet_chemical are describing the shape and aggregate state class_D is refering to some standard cheers, Martin
